PowerFxコパイロットの紹介

PowerFxコパイロットは、PowerFxコーディングのドメインにおけるエキスパートアシスタントとして設計されており、ユーザーにPowerFxコードの記述と理解に関する深い洞察とガイダンスを提供します。その主な設計目的は、Power Platform環境内での開発プロセスを容易にすることであり、ユーザーがアプリケーションをより簡単かつ効率的に作成または変更したり、ワークフローを自動化したり、データを分析したりできるようにすることです。広範な知識ベースと実践的な経験を活用することにより、PowerFxコパイロットは、ベストプラクティス、トラブルシューティング、機能要件を効果的なPowerFxスクリプトに変換する方法についての洞察を提供します。たとえば、ユーザーが特定の基準に基づいてデータセットをフィルタリングするカスタムフォーミュラを作成しようとしている場合、PowerFxコパイロットは構文、例、PowerAppsキャンバス内でこのフォーミュラを構築および最適化する方法の説明を提供できます。 Powered by ChatGPT-4o

PowerFx Copilotの主な機能

  • 構文とコード生成

    Example Example

    ある日付以降のレコードについてデータセットをフィルタリングするためのユーザー要件が与えられた場合、PowerFxコパイロットは次のPowerFxフォーミュラを生成できます: `Filter(DataSource, DateColumn > DateValue)`。

    Example Scenario

    これは、ユーザー入力に基づく動的フィルタリングが必要なPowerApps内のアプリ開発で特に役立ちます。

  • トラブルシューティングと最適化

    Example Example

    ユーザーがアプリのパフォーマンスの問題に遭遇した場合、PowerFxコパイロットは委任可能な関数や、非効率をもたらす特定のパターンを回避するなどの最適化戦略を提案できます。

    Example Scenario

    これにより、ユーザーはアプリを改良して、特に大規模なデータセットや複雑な論理を持つアプリのスムーズな操作を確実にすることができます。

  • ベストプラクティスとガイダンス

    Example Example

    PowerFxコパイロットは、複雑なフォーミュラをよりシンプルな名前付きフォーミュラに分割するなど、コードの可読性と保守性のための構造に関するアドバイスを提供します。

    Example Scenario

    このアドバイスは、共有プロジェクトに携わるチームにとって貴重であり、すべてのチームメンバーがアプリを簡単に理解して変更できるようにすることを保証します。

PowerFxコパイロット サービスの理想的なユーザー

  • Power Platform デベロッパー

    Power Platform内のソリューションを開発している個人またはチーム。パワーアプリ、パワーオートメート、Power BIなどが含まれます。これらのユーザーは、PowerFxコパイロットによって、より効率的かつ効果的なコードの記述についての洞察を得て、開発プロセスを速め、アプリのパフォーマンスを改善することができます。

  • 非技術系ビジネスユーザー

    ビジネスアナリスト、プロジェクトマネージャー、その他の非技術役割を担う人たちは、アプリケーションとワークフローを作成または変更するためにPower Platformを使用します。彼らは、PowerFx Copilotによって、深い技術知識を必要とせずに、論理とデータ操作をソリューションに組み込むための、簡略化されたガイド付きアプローチを得ることができます。

PowerFxコパイロットの使用方法

  • はじめの一歩

    はいチャットaiで無料体験を開始。ログインやChatGPT Plusへの登録は不要です。

  • PowerFxの理解

    PowerFx言語の基本を理解して、構文と機能を把握する。

  • 必要条件の特定

    PowerFxコパイロットで解決したい特定のコーディングニーズや問題を決定する。

  • コパイロットとの対話

    直接的で具体的な質問やコーディングシナリオを提示してコパイロットと相互作用する。

  • 適用と改善

    提供されたソリューションをプロジェクトで利用し、さらなる明確化や最適化のアドバイスのために戻る。

PowerFxコパイロット よくある質問

  • PowerFx Copilotの主な用途は何ですか?

    PowerFxコパイロットは、PowerFxコードの理解と記述を支援するために設計されており、特定のコーディングクエリに合わせたソリューションと説明を提供します。

  • PowerFxコパイロットは複雑なコーディングの問題を助けることができますか?

    はい、複雑なPowerFxの問題についてもガイダンスを提供できます。ソリューションを理解しやすいステップに分割し、ベストプラクティスを提案します。

  • PowerFxコパイロットは初心者に適していますか?

    はい、コパイロットはPowerFxの構文と概念を学ぶのに最適で、コーディングへの実践的なアプローチを提供できます。

  • PowerFxコパイロットはコードのエラーをどのように処理しますか?

    コード内のエラーを特定し修正を提供することができます。これらのエラーの原因を説明することができます。

  • PowerFx Copilotで既存のコードの最適化を提案できますか?

    はい。既存のPowerFxコードを分析し、効率とパフォーマンス向上のための最適化を推奨することができます。